For contractors joining the Mistlewood digest project: the batch email scheduler's old setting `DIGEST_CRON_WINDOW` has been renamed to `DIGEST_DISPATCH_WINDOW` to match the dispatcher service's terminology. The old name still works but logs a deprecation warning and will be removed in 4.0. Please update any env files you've copied from earlier branches, and double-check the timezone suffix — several missed digests last quarter traced back to that. The dispatcher also authenticates to the mail relay, so your env file needs this line:

secret setting of bageg-bagag: ARCHIVE_KEY3=e2f

Handover note — Crumbwheel order cutoffs.

Welcome aboard. The bakery cutoff rule in Crumbwheel closes same-day orders at 14:00 local to each storefront, not UTC — this has bitten us twice. Holiday overrides live in the calendar service and take precedence silently, so always check there first when a cutoff looks wrong. To unlock the calendar service's admin console after a restart, enter the recovery passphrase below.

vault phrase of bagap-bahaf = silion-pelox-sorox-casdor-quenwyn-fraax-eliox-praael-kelion-quenvan-kasox-rusael-norius-belvan

Q: Why is the Cartquick prefetcher hammering the tile origin?

A: Usually a cache-key mismatch after a style deploy — every tile looks new. Check the hit-rate panel first. If it's below 40%, pause the prefetcher and purge the stale keyspace. Steps, dashboards, and the pause toggle are all documented on this page:

wiki page, tahaf-tajog: https://jira.ordindyn.corp/pipeline